The client is seeking an Executive Chef for Morningside University located in Sioux City, IA. Morningside University is a private, four-year, co-educational institution with 23 buildings on a 68-acre campus in a scenic, secure residential area of Sioux City, IA (population 140,000) and is on the National Register of Historic Places. The College enrolls more than 1,250 full-time students. Although the majority of students hail from Iowa and Nebraska, Morningside draws students from more than 25 states and several foreign countries.
This Executive Chef will manage 30 employees and be responsible for culinary operations for the main dining hall, multiple food retail locations, food production and Catering.
